A key international gateway for central Punjab, supporting both civilian and military aviation.


Faisalabad International Airport (LYP) is located 10 kilometers southwest of Faisalabad city center on Jhang Road. It serves as a vital hub for the region, connecting Faisalabad and surrounding cities to domestic and international destinations. The airport also functions as a standby base for the Pakistan Air Force and hosts two flying schools for pilot training.

Several Pakistan International Airlines (PIA) flights were delayed at Faisalabad International Airport (LYP) on January 26, 2024, due to low visibility caused by dense fog.
The ongoing capacity enhancement project at Faisalabad International Airport (LYP) is nearing completion, aiming to increase passenger handling capacity and improve airport infrastructure.
Faisalabad International Airport (LYP) welcomed its latest aircraft, a Boeing 737, marking a significant step in bolstering air connectivity in the region.

Passenger processing times at LYP generally range from 30 to 60 minutes, depending on the time of day and the number of passengers traveling. Security checks and passport control are the primary steps in this process.
Faisalabad International Airport handles various cargo and freight operations, including warehousing and customs clearance services. Dedicated teams manage the movement of goods through the airport’s cargo facilities.
Taxis and ride-sharing services readily provide access to Faisalabad International Airport. Airport shuttle services are also available for pre-booked transportation to nearby hotels and destinations.
